And the roof of your mouth like good wine flowing down smoothly for my loved one, moving gently over my lips and my teeth.
I am for my loved one, and his desire is for me.
Come, my loved one, let us go out into the field; let us take rest among the cypress-trees.
Let us go out early to the vine-gardens; let us see if the vine is in bud, if it has put out its young fruit, and the pomegranate is in flower. There I will give you my love.
The mandrakes give out a sweet smell, and at our doors are all sorts of good fruits, new and old, which I have kept for my loved one.
